iData System Engineer

E-Infosol LLCWashington, DC

About The Position

E-INFOSOL is searching for a highly motivated Senior iData System Engineer to be a full-time employee in Washington, DC to join our innovative and customer solutions focused team. Job Description: The Senior iData System Engineer is responsible for the following: Maintain system operations for an application and infrastructure across multiple environments including production, pre-production, and staging environments within the system accreditation boundary.  Coordinate, engage, with other technical agency entities such as ICAM for authentication, on-premises could for vSphere, and networks for F5 load balancer to support diagnostics for user access, and network route-ability for application operational optimization.  Maintain and manage primary and secondary operational on-prem cloud environments in coordination with on-premises cloud infrastructure to support primary and secondary failover site deployments and operations.  Manage existing and implement new application service accounts for REST API service consumption for external systems.  Experienced in Microsoft .NET computer software framework, AppFabric, web-based development using Model-View-Controller (MVC) and repository patterns, SharePoint Server, and FAST Search.  Provide customer and stakeholder support for quarterly application enhancements, new features, and bugfixes within Agile Release Train.  Provide end-user helpdesk and inquiry support for application data managers and end-users. Supervise, coordinate and/or design, develop and perform additions and changes to network hardware, infrastructure server environments, and operating systems, and attached devices, including investigation, analysis, recommendation, configuration, installation, and testing of new network hardware and software.  Provide direct support in the day-to-day operations on network hardware and operating systems including the evaluation of system utilization, monitoring response time and primary support for detection and correction of operational problems.  Troubleshoot at the physical level of the network, working with network measurement hardware and software, as well as physical checking and testing of hardware devices at the logical level working with communication protocols.  Participate in planning design, technical review and implementation for new network infrastructure hardware and network operating systems for voice and data communication networks.  Perform systems management and integration functions.  Exhibiting proficiency with virtualization technologies and network administration.  Maintain network infrastructure standards including network communication protocols such as TCP/IP.  Provide technical consultation, training and support for IT staff as designated by the government.  Diagnose and resolve complex communication problems. Perform systems management and integration functions.  Responsible for design, deployment, evaluating, testing, certification, patching, addressing interoperability issues, not only of the base storage & backup system, but for all features, components, and application dependencies. Ensures systems are current with approved patches and assists with certification and system accreditation tasks, composes SOPs, and Quick Reference guides for users.  Provide top level technical expertise responsible for design and development of a client/server environment.  Develop strategy of client/server system and the design infrastructure necessary to support that strategy.  Advise on selection of technological purchases with regards to processing, data storage, data access, and applications development.  Set standards for the client/server relational database structure for the organization. Advises of feasibility of potential future projects to management.   Responsible for the design, development, testing, and management of the application development projects in support of IT infrastructure. This includes the programmatic integration of third-party components, the introduction of new custom capabilities, modification of existing code, process improvement recommendation, and automation of operations and maintenance tasks.  Develop and implement technical efforts to design, build, and deploy applications in the direction of lead architects, including large-scale data processing, computationally intensive statistical modeling, and advanced analytics.  Participate in all aspects of the software development life cycle for all solutions, including planning, requirements, development, testing, and quality assurance.  Duties include technical project milestone reviews, code architecture sessions, resource estimation, and development best practices knowledge transfer.

Requirements

  • Active Top Secret Clearance
  • Bachelor’s degree in Computer Science, IT, or related field
  • Minimum 8 years of experience
  • Experience with managing and configuring IIS and IIS hosted applications
  • Proficiency at SQL server database querying, maintenance and performance tuning
  • Microsoft .NET, AppFabric, SharePoint Server, Model-View-Controller (MVC) web-based development, and FAST search experience
  • Exhibiting proficiency with virtualization technologies and network administration.

Nice To Haves

  • Knowledge of Web API, ASP.NET Core and Entity Framework ORM are desirable
  • General knowledge of and familiarity with source control (Git)

Responsibilities

  • Maintain system operations for an application and infrastructure across multiple environments including production, pre-production, and staging environments within the system accreditation boundary.
  • Coordinate, engage, with other technical agency entities such as ICAM for authentication, on-premises could for vSphere, and networks for F5 load balancer to support diagnostics for user access, and network route-ability for application operational optimization.
  • Maintain and manage primary and secondary operational on-prem cloud environments in coordination with on-premises cloud infrastructure to support primary and secondary failover site deployments and operations.
  • Manage existing and implement new application service accounts for REST API service consumption for external systems.
  • Provide customer and stakeholder support for quarterly application enhancements, new features, and bugfixes within Agile Release Train.
  • Provide end-user helpdesk and inquiry support for application data managers and end-users.
  • Supervise, coordinate and/or design, develop and perform additions and changes to network hardware, infrastructure server environments, and operating systems, and attached devices, including investigation, analysis, recommendation, configuration, installation, and testing of new network hardware and software.
  • Provide direct support in the day-to-day operations on network hardware and operating systems including the evaluation of system utilization, monitoring response time and primary support for detection and correction of operational problems.
  • Troubleshoot at the physical level of the network, working with network measurement hardware and software, as well as physical checking and testing of hardware devices at the logical level working with communication protocols.
  • Participate in planning design, technical review and implementation for new network infrastructure hardware and network operating systems for voice and data communication networks.
  • Perform systems management and integration functions.
  • Maintain network infrastructure standards including network communication protocols such as TCP/IP.
  • Provide technical consultation, training and support for IT staff as designated by the government.
  • Diagnose and resolve complex communication problems. Perform systems management and integration functions.
  • Responsible for design, deployment, evaluating, testing, certification, patching, addressing interoperability issues, not only of the base storage & backup system, but for all features, components, and application dependencies. Ensures systems are current with approved patches and assists with certification and system accreditation tasks, composes SOPs, and Quick Reference guides for users.
  • Provide top level technical expertise responsible for design and development of a client/server environment.
  • Develop strategy of client/server system and the design infrastructure necessary to support that strategy.
  • Advise on selection of technological purchases with regards to processing, data storage, data access, and applications development.
  • Set standards for the client/server relational database structure for the organization. Advises of feasibility of potential future projects to management.
  • Responsible for the design, development, testing, and management of the application development projects in support of IT infrastructure. This includes the programmatic integration of third-party components, the introduction of new custom capabilities, modification of existing code, process improvement recommendation, and automation of operations and maintenance tasks.
  • Develop and implement technical efforts to design, build, and deploy applications in the direction of lead architects, including large-scale data processing, computationally intensive statistical modeling, and advanced analytics.
  • Participate in all aspects of the software development life cycle for all solutions, including planning, requirements, development, testing, and quality assurance.
  • Duties include technical project milestone reviews, code architecture sessions, resource estimation, and development best practices knowledge transfer.

Benefits

  • Medical – 100% company paid for employees with dependent options
  • Dental and Vision
  • Retirement Savings (401k) up to 4% match
  • Health Savings Account (HSA), FSA and DCFSA
  • Company-paid Short/Long-term disability (w/ additional supplemental options)
  • Company-paid Life and AD&D (w/ additional supplemental options)
  • Generous Paid Time Off and ALL 11 Federal Holidays
  • Legal and Identity Protection Services
  • Bonuses for certifications and reimbursement
  • UberOne, Company Outings (Sporting events, Happy Hours, etc.), Discounts on services including Pet Insurance
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service